Rough Timing Layout

Set to a small section of Mozart's Claniet Concerto in A

0.12 – Maera emerges from coral and seaweed
0.26 – Twisting dance sequence
0.30 – Looks around for something else to dance with
0.38 – Comes up with an idea! Hooray!
0.42 – Starts making a fish
1:05 – Fish is created , choreographed dance sequence
1:20 – One friend isn’t quite enough
1:30 – Makes jellyfish
1:40 – Makes another fish
1:45 – Choreographed dance sequence with the fish and jellyfish
1:53 – The fish swim down into the seaweed
1:57 – Maera beckons them back up
2:01 – They swim down again
2:06 – She makes another 2 fish
2:16 – All the fish swim away
2:19 – Choreographed dance for Maera alone
2:29 – Others start to come back
2:30 – Maera dances faster, making more fish and jellyfish
2:39 – Maera creates an eel
2:47 – Eel dances around Maera
2:53 – Short choreographed dance sequence
2:59 – All the fish swim up (choreographed)
3:03 – Fish swim down in choreographed lines
3:07 – Maera dances above the rest
3:09 – Main choreographed dance sequence
3:27 - End
